    What a septic system actually does

    It assists to picture what is actually happening under the top. Wastewater coming from your house gets into the septic system, solids settle down as sediment, as well as body fats float to the leading as film. The area between, clearer but unclean, vacates with the channel baffle to the drainfield. Bacteria inside the tank absorb a part of the solids, but not all of it. The rest builds up until you arrange sewage-disposal tank cleaning.

    Two information matter much more than lots of people realize. First, baffles perform actual job. The inlet baffle soothes the influx so it does not stir the tank, and also the store baffle always keeps film coming from heading to the drainfield. Second, the drainfield depends on uniformly circulated, reduced solids effluent. If even more solids or oil slide past times, the soil pores choke as well as the field fails early. Really good sewage-disposal tank maintenance is not nearly the tank, it has to do with guarding the drainfield.

    What standard septic system cleaning includes

    Traditional service concentrates on sewage-disposal tank pumping and also assessment. A suction truck clears away the sludge and also scum. A professional technician will definitely swing the bottom along with a wand, upset the materials to split cleared up layers, and also backflush to release heavy down payments. Done right, septic system emptying leaves merely a lean biofilm on the walls as well as baffles. You perform not desire a sterilized tank, you yearn for a reset.

    This see ought to likewise consist of an examination. We take a look at baffle situation, procedure sediment and also algae intensity, check the tank's structural condition, and also, if available, lift the distribution carton cover to observe just how effluent leaves the tank. In more mature tanks, I typically find a missing out on channel baffle or a decayed concrete baffle. That is a peaceful body deadly. Replacing that component throughout the same visit stops years of slow-moving drainfield damage.

    Most households require this company every 2 to 5 years. The precise period depends upon tank size, number of occupants, waste disposal unit use, and also behaviors. A three-bedroom home with a 1,000 gallon tank and a household of four tends to strike the 3 year score if the home kitchen views a lot of food preparation. A weekend log cabin with two people could extend to 5 and even 7 years. If you are not sure, solution solids rather than suspecting. After the 1st qualified check out, ask for the gunge and scum deepness analyses as well as prepared the timetable from those numbers.

    Where hydro-jetting fits

    Hydro-jetting uses high stress water to search the within pipes or, in specific conditions, the inside of tanks and also distribution containers. Our company feed a hose pipe with a concentrated nozzle in to free throw line and also energy out guts, oil, and soft roots. The water tension may range from about 1,500 to 4,000 psi for residential job, with different nozzles for cutting grease, passing through blockages, or even cleansing the pipe area. The secret is actually certainly not maximum stress, it is actually matching mist nozzle as well as approach to the pipe product and the problem.

    Two different hydro-jetting contexts matter along with septic tanks:

    • Line jetting. Cleansing the inlet line from your home to the tank, the outlet line coming from the tank to the circulation container, as well as in some cases the lateral pipes in the drainfield. This is actually where hydro-jetting sparkles. It hits what a vacuum cleaner truck can certainly not, removes stubborn grease and also paper mats, as well as restores flow.

    • Tank or part washing. Light jetting in the tank to separate compacted grease, or in the distribution carton to clear clogs. This is much more medical. It should be actually performed with care so you do certainly not damage baffles or even emulsify large lots of oil that after that clean right into the field.

    I have enjoyed jetting turn a day-long excavation into a two-hour repair, as well as I have actually additionally found it made use of at the incorrect opportunity, which only relocated the concern downstream. The judgment phone call is actually understanding when water energy fixes the right concern, and when pumping as well as basic corrections will definitely do.

    Cost, time, as well as what modifies the math

    A regular sewage-disposal tank cleaning for a common 1,000 to 1,250 gallon tank commonly falls anywhere coming from 300 to 600 bucks, relying on access, location, as well as how much time the staff invests in agitation as well as examination. Hydro-jetting incorporates price. Anticipate 200 to 600 dollars even more for jetting a single line, and much more if a number of lines or laterals are involved, or even if video camera diagnostics become part of the work. Rates go up when tops are submerged deep, accessibility is tight, or even winter season ground health conditions slow the work.

    The right time for jetting is typically when you possess signs that lead to a pipes problem, not a tank intensity trouble. Right here are the patterns I view:

    If the system supports under heavy water use, such as laundry washing day or a long shower, yet you recently had septic tank emptying, assume channel baffle or electrical outlet line limitation. If a singular restroom purls, not the whole residence, think the division line from that shower room to the primary or an airing vent issue. If the lawn over the drainfield is actually much lusher as well as you smell sewer near the field, the trouble is not an easy line obstruction, and jetting laterals could merely provide brief relief.

    Hydro-jetting makes the best feeling when the target is to repair total pipeline diameter and also smooth indoor wall surfaces, which boosts lasting circulation. It is actually less valuable if the issue is a saturated drainfield or a busted water pipes. That is actually where a pump vehicle, a cam, as well as often a trowel tell you what happens next.

    A deeper check out standard pumping technique

    Not all pushing appears the very same in the business. On a well-run service call, we begin by opening up both the inlet and electrical outlet tops if the tank possesses all of them. That enables us to see as well as function each enclosure, which matters on two-compartment tanks. Our company assess sediment and also scum, keep in mind any kind of pungent or even chemical smells that might mention cleansers or solvents in the tank, as well as check out water table about the channel. A tank over channel elevation advises a downstream constraint. A tank below recommends a leak.

    During pushing our company split the sludge layer with a wand rather than allowing the truck job passively. Tight sludge can easily sit like moist clay-based unless you disturb it. If an individual has actually gone a years between solutions, the bottom may be as company as brownish breadstuff. Without rocking, a great section will continue to be and transplant. Great septic system maintenance concerns efficiency, certainly not only transporting away gallons.

    After emptying, our team assess the baffles. If a concrete baffle has actually eroded to a nub, we review replacing it with a sanitary tee and a filter on the outlet. That filter is inexpensive insurance. It captures lost solids as well as could be rinsed out at the tank, rather than letting a mistake reach the field.

    Hydro-jetting tools and also just how they differ

    There are a few faucet kinds you will become aware of. A penetrator mist nozzle focuses water onward to drill by means of a blockage. A flusher uses jets that angle back to pull the hose along as well as wash particles towards the tank. A rotary nozzle rotates to clean the entire interior, which is optimal for grease as well as biofilm. For roots, our company typically match hydro-jetting along with a mechanical cutter machine if the pipe is actually PVC and our company can do so properly. In older Orangeburg or even weak clay ceramic tile, tough cutting threats collapse. There, lesser tension, even more water amount, and also perseverance obtain you 90 per-cent of the result without harm.

    For residential septic job, I favor beginning mild. Lots of lines are four-inch PVC along with glued fittings. Hit those along with 4,000 psi and an aggressive head while the water pipes is actually threatened through destruction, and also you can make a joint leak. A brilliant strategy is actually initial camera job if accessibility makes it possible for, a lightweight exchange repair circulation, then a cleansing pass to complete the job. When laterals are involved, our experts only jet after confirming there is a spot for clutter to go which we are certainly not pressing solids right into a failing field.

    Real-world scenarios that present the decision

    Two winters months back, I explored a 1978 cattle ranch along with recurring backups every 6 full weeks. The individual had septic tank pumping done two times that year, each opportunity with temporary alleviation. Our experts opened up the tank, observed a healthy and balanced fluid degree, and a clean outlet baffle along with a filter. That told me the tank was certainly not the problem. A video camera at the electrical outlet line reached a choke point right just before the circulation carton, where years of grease had tricked up. The solution was actually a measured hydro-jetting elapsed coming from the tank to the box, after that a rinse. No digging, no guess work. I advised a kitchen area grease catch since the bride and groom operated a small baking business coming from home. They incorporated it, and also the line has actually been actually crystal clear since.

    On the other palm, a country bistro along with a huge septic system always kept requiring jetting of their laterals every spring season. Our experts can travel the laterals as well as receive them limping along, however the groundwater level rose each thaw, as well as the soil can certainly not drain pipes. The right response there was certainly not more jetting. It was a revamped drainfield along with much better altitude and a dosing tank. Hydro-jetting aided diagnose through showing that circulation returned after washing yet fell short again along with higher groundwater. This spared them coming from spending for loyal short-lived remedies that would never last.

    Risks and exactly how to stay away from them

    Every device has actually negative aspects if mistreated. Along with hydro-jetting, you wish to avoid 3 oversights. To begin with, carry out certainly not plane thoughtlessly right into a delicate or broke down product line. Look or even at least probe to begin with. An electronic camera is gold listed below. Second, carry out certainly not emulsify a dense mat of grease inside the tank as well as deliver it straight into the store. If a tank is gravely greasy, pump and scrape just before any cleaning, then install a filter. Third, do not manage a lifeless drainfield as a cleaning complication. If the industry is ponding as well as the ground is actually saturated, hydro-jetting might generate a short-term channel, but the biomat and also soil capability problems are going to remain.

    Even typical pushing possesses mistakes. Drawing just the liquid and keeping the thickest solids responsible for is a common one when the workers is actually rushed. Therefore is neglecting to check and also substitute a skipping channel baffle. If your company is in and out in twenty minutes, you possibly carried out not receive a total septic system cleaning.

    Maintenance that maintains you off the unexpected emergency list

    The most affordable repair in septic job is avoiding an issue. A household that discovers to always keep grease away from the sink can easily increase the time between jetting telephone calls. A dust filter on the washing discharge maintains threads from constituting floor coverings. Spreading out water use aids the drainfield remainder as well as breathe. Chemical ingredients make major promises, but I hardly view all of them deliver the results declared. Some germs items are actually harmless, a couple of are actually helpful in grease catch management, as well as some synthetic cleaning agent based cleaners could be outright harmful to a tank. If you are attracted by an additive, ask a regional professional that services your soil kind as well as temperature. Their field notes matter greater than the label.

    If you possess a waste disposal, adjust your pumping routine earlier. Disposals include finely ground solids that act additional like sand than absorbable food items, and also they work out in to a dense layer. I often encourage every 2 to 3 years for hefty fingertip customers, specifically along with a much smaller tank.

    Winter delivers its very own policies. In freeze nation, stay clear of leaving tops available long after company, and always keep traffic off frosted drainfields. Jetting in harsh cold may develop ice at cleanouts and also lids, which makes complex recuperation. If you understand you possess a line that suches as to stop up in February, doing preventative hydro-jetting in the autumn is a much less difficult plan.

    Edge cases as well as judgment calls

    Older tanks can be cast-in-place concrete, precast, and even steel. Steel tanks rust severely and become harmful to stroll near. If I observe a steel tank, I start chatting substitute, certainly not travelling or even hostile cleansing. Orangeburg pipeline, utilized coming from the 1940s by means of the 1970s, is a tar-impregnated fiber water pipes that warps eventually. Hydro-jetting may assist clean it, yet the long-term fix is actually replacement. Clay ceramic tile with offset joints allows origins in. You may jet out the origins and place a root-control froth in some community contexts, but in septic work you still encounter groundwater and soil movement. Expect travelling to become servicing, not cure.

    On pressure-dosed or even advanced therapy bodies with media filters, the cleaning discussion changes. Those units frequently possess regular filter cleanings and also pump enclosure company that look nothing at all like a typical tank. Hydro-jetting there is actually typically focused on laterals as well as manifolds, as well as stress are specified based on supplier specs. When unsure, examine the system tag or even area files to validate you are actually dealing with the best component with the correct technique.

    How professionals determine without guessing

    The absolute best service check outs observe a straightforward logic. Begin along with opinion. If the tank is actually overfull, your regulation is downstream. If the tank is actually regular and the house is actually backing up, examine the inlet. If the tank possesses an ordinary amount as well as the inlet as well as outlet series look clear, think venting or interior plumbing. Make use of the minimum invasive action that can identify correctly. A clear cleanout and a cam save time. If a video camera will not pass, that informs you where to spray. After cleaning, verify function under flow, not only an empty pipe. Operate a fitting, see the tank, as well as be actually self-assured the trouble is actually dealt with, not only delayed.
